The World Before Gutenberg
Before Gutenberg, European book production was slow and expensive. Scribes meticulously copied texts, often introducing errors. This meant copies of the same book could vary significantly. Knowledge was decentralized and often imperfect.
Monasteries served as primary centers for book creation and preservation. Their libraries held vast, but largely inaccessible, collections. Access to these texts was restricted, limiting the spread of new ideas and discoveries.
Education primarily relied on oral tradition and rote memorization. Scholars traveled great distances to consult rare texts. This system severely hampered the rapid advancement of science, philosophy, and general learning.
Gutenbergās Ingenious Innovation
Johannes Gutenberg, a German goldsmith, brought together several existing technologies. He combined movable metal type, a new oil-based ink, and a modified wine press. This combination created an efficient system for mass-producing identical texts.
His key breakthrough was the development of durable, reusable metal type for each letter. This allowed for quick arrangement of pages and easy correction of errors. It was a groundbreaking leap from earlier block printing methods.
The oil-based ink was another crucial component. It adhered better to metal type and paper, producing clearer, more consistent impressions than previous water-based inks. This ensured high-quality, readable texts.
The Dawn of Mass Production
The immediate effect of Gutenbergās press was an explosion in book production. What once took months now took days. This dramatically reduced the cost of books, making them accessible to a much broader audience.
The famous Gutenberg Bible, printed around 1455, was among the first major works. Its precision and beauty showcased the pressās potential. It set a new standard for textual clarity and uniformity.
This increased availability meant more people could learn to read. Literacy rates began to climb steadily across Europe. This helpful shift laid the groundwork for future societal and intellectual growth.
A Catalyst for the Reformation
The printing press played a pivotal role in the Protestant Reformation. Martin Lutherās Ninety-five Theses, critical of the Catholic Church, were quickly printed and distributed widely. This allowed his ideas to spread like wildfire.
Suddenly, religious texts, especially the Bible, became available in vernacular languages. People could read scriptures for themselves, rather than relying solely on interpretations from religious authorities.
This direct access to religious texts fostered individual interpretation and questioning. It challenged the established religious order and empowered common people with spiritual autonomy. This was a significant shift in power.
Advancing Science and Exploration
Before the press, scientific discoveries and observations were difficult to share accurately. Hand-copied scientific texts often contained errors, hindering progress and leading to confusion among scholars.
The printing press ensured accurate, identical copies of scientific works. This allowed researchers across different regions to build upon each otherās findings with confidence. It standardized scientific communication.
Key ways the printing press aided science:
* Standardized Texts: Ensured consistent versions of scientific treatises.
* Faster Dissemination: Rapidly spread new theories and experimental results.
* Collaborative Learning: Enabled scholars to critique and improve upon othersā work.
* Illustrative Accuracy: Allowed for reproducible diagrams and maps, crucial for anatomy and cartography.
Explorers like Christopher Columbus benefited from printed maps and travel accounts. These printed guides offered useful information and helped inspire further voyages of discovery. The press made knowledge a shared resource.
Fueling Education and Literacy
The proliferation of books made education more accessible. Universities could now provide standardized textbooks to all students. This improved the quality and consistency of learning across institutions.
More people learned to read as books became cheaper and more common. This rising literacy rate created a greater demand for even more printed materials, creating a positive feedback loop. It was a truly helpful development.
This era saw the rise of public libraries and schools. Education was no longer solely for the clergy or the wealthy. It became a pathway for social mobility and intellectual engagement for many more individuals.
Shaping Political and Social Thought
The printing press became a powerful tool for political discourse. Pamphlets, manifestos, and newspapers emerged, spreading political ideas and criticisms rapidly. This gave rise to public opinion in a new way.
It facilitated the spread of revolutionary ideas, contributing to movements like the Enlightenment. Thinkers like Voltaire and Rousseau saw their philosophies reach a broad audience, influencing future revolutions.
Governments and rulers also used the press. They printed laws, decrees, and propaganda to maintain control or sway public sentiment. The press became a battleground for ideas, offering advice and counter-advice.
Impacts on society and politics:
* Rise of Public Opinion: Enabled widespread discussion and formation of collective viewpoints.
* Political Mobilization: Facilitated the organization of social and political movements.
* Standardization of Laws: Ensured uniform application and understanding of legal codes.
* National Identity: Helped forge common cultural and linguistic bonds within nations.
The ability to share dissenting views widely posed a new challenge to authoritarian regimes. Censorship became an ongoing struggle, as authorities tried to control the flow of information.
Standardizing Language and Culture
As books became more common, so did a need for standardized spellings and grammar. Printers often adopted specific regional dialects, which then became more widely accepted through printed materials.
This process helped solidify national languages, such as English, French, and German. Vernacular literature flourished, fostering a sense of shared cultural identity among people speaking the same language.
The press also preserved and disseminated folklore, songs, and historical accounts. This cultural preservation helped communities understand their shared heritage and traditions, creating a unified cultural fabric.

Q. Were There Other Forms Of Printing Before Gutenberg?
A: Yes, block printing was used in China centuries before Gutenberg, where entire pages were carved into wooden blocks. Movable type also originated in China and Korea, but Gutenbergās system was the first to be widely adopted in the West.
Q. How Did The Printing Press Contribute To The Age Of Exploration?
A: It allowed for the mass production of accurate maps, travel accounts, and navigational guides. These printed materials provided crucial information for explorers and helped inspire and plan new voyages of discovery.
Q. What Materials Were Used In Early Printing Presses?
A: Early printing presses typically used durable metal type (often lead alloys), oil-based inks, and paper. The press itself was usually made of wood, modeled after agricultural presses like those used for wine or olives.
